The Intel Core i5-13600HX: A Mid-Range Processor with High-End Performance

Core i5

The Intel Core i5-13600HX is a fast mid-range mobile processor of the Raptor Lake series. It is expected to be announced in early 2023. The CPU integrates 6 fast Raptor Cove performance cores (P-cores) with HyperThreading and 8 Gracemont efficiency cores without HyperThreading.

Raptor Cove Micro-architecture

The P-Cores clock between 2.6 GHz (base) up to 4.8 GHz (single core boost, all-core 4.5 GHz). The smaller E-Cores clock between 1.9 and 3.6 GHz. All cores can access the combined 24 MB L3 cache. The CPU supports vPro (Enterprise) management features.

Compared to Alder Lake Compared to Alder Lake, Raptor Lake offers improved P-Cores (Raptor Cove micro-architecture) with bigger Caches and more E-Cores (same Gracemont micro-architecture). Furthermore, the chip supports faster DDR5 memory (up to 5600 MHz for the 13980HX, but only 4800 MHz for the i7).

Production process

The CPU is still produced in the 10nm process (Intel 7) with additional refinements.
